Western Australia adventure – 9 July 2025

We have had a mix of wild weather and not so wild weather. Today has been a bit extreme with wind but the rain has been welcome and it’s sculptured the dunes so a lot of photographs taken and wood collected to keep warm.

Plenty of interesting flotsam and jetsam washed ashore, big cuttlefish bones and heaps of seagrass. Pink Cockatoos feeding and roosting on Leeside of dunes.

Grey sky and stormy winds 45+ knot winds make for some dramatic scenery. Wandered around fields of rhizomorphs and the hummocks of sand with vegetation that lost the battle with the elements.
